I previously released an override for my towel, which meant after bathing sims would automatically wear the towel and the Standard SimpleChest shape. This update fixes that, so your sims will instead display the chest shape you've chosen for them in the Body Selector!
A couple of important notes:
1) I did not create this fix. The fix involves a scripting mod, which was created and kindly shared with me by user fpttsu. I'm still in the early learning stages of learning scripting, so all credit for the fix goes to fpttsu - both for making it, and for allowing me to share it with others so everyone can benefit!

The zip contains four files:
- The towel. Required.
- The script mod fixing the override. Required if you want to see correct chest shapes on sims using the override.
- Two versions of the override - one white, and one multi-color. You can ONLY USE ONE of these overrides, so put the version in your game that you want to see!
For example - if you want your sims to have their correct chests and to have random multi-colored towels, you would install the following THREE files: the towel, the script, and the override_multicolor.
NOTES:
I'm sure most people use WW, so you've probably already done this, but if you haven't - you need to enable Script Mods in your TS4 in-game settings in order for script mods to work.
Also, in order for the game to properly read a script mod, it cannot be more than one folder deep in your /Mods directory. As an example, /Mods/Simdulgence would work, but /Mods/Simdulgence/Overrides would not.
